There's no clear difference as the line of distinction varies from countries to countries. In Japan, for example, a place having more than 50,000 inhabitants is termed a city. Going by this logic, we will have more than 1000 cities in Nigeria.

Some sources believed a town to be geographical location that has its own governing body or government area. So I guess places with more than a LGA can call itself a city then. Offa in kwara state has a single LGA and thus is a town while Ogbomoso with 5 LGAs is a city within that context.

United Nations use the population of people residing in an area to classify it as Hamlets, Village, Town, city, Megapolis and whatnot...

It's not necessarily the infrastructure in an area that makes it a town or city. Because even some small villages in the Western World have some cutting edge infrastructure that a so called city in a third world country doesn't have.
